dc.description.abstractThis project has been developed in the semiconductor manufacturing company Infineon Technologies AG, in Neubiberg (Germany). The project is focused on Digital Twins and Semantic Web. Digital Twins are the ultimate solutions for companies to get a more accurate simulation to perform intensely detailed and risk-free experiments. Semantic Web uses knowledge graphs to make data understandable for humans and machines. Simulation models combined with Semantic Web can together increase the reusability of the created models. Infineon Technologies AG is currently starting to work for a Digital Twin of its Supply Chain. This project takes place at the early steps of it, where the focus is set on the knowledge connection of simulations through the Semantic Web. Infineon Technologies is also working in the Digital reference, a Semantic Web-based solution applied to the semiconductor domainthat already sets the foundation for the project.The project aims to get an understanding ofhow to build simulation models automatically and enabled by ontologies and, more specifically, by the Digital Reference. The development of the project is divided intotwo parts: the first part looks at an overall solution for all domains and the second one focuses on the company where the project has been developed.Firstly, focusing on a solution for any domain on how to define a solution that creates simulation models based on ontologies. The framework is then applied to the specific use case selected in Infineon Technologies AG. The answeris an intermediate engine that creates a model for the simulation software utilizing the user’s input as model requirements and retrieving different bits of information from the Digital Reference the model is built by an engine.The project is closed with some recommendations for future steps to make this engine a reality, an economical and environmental analysis of the project, and conclusions.
